Platform
Features
Pricing
Working Power
Contact
No bio yet
Bracken Hendricks
Co-founder and chair
Sign up to view 2 direct reports
Get started
This person is not in any teams
Doral Renewables
Halliwell
Gruppo Bonzano
Scottish Renewables
metergrid GmbH